G4013

περιάγω

periago

per-ee-ag'-o

Verb

from G4012 and G71; to take around (as a companion); reflexively, to walk around:--compass, go (round) about, lead about.

  1. to lead around, to lead about with one's self
  2. to go about, walk about

G4022

περιέρχομαι

perierchomai

per-ee-er'-khom-ahee

Verb

from G4012 and G2064 (including its alternate); to come all around, i.e. stroll, vacillate, veer:--fetch a compass, vagabond, wandering about.

  1. to go about
    1. of strollers
    2. of wanderers
    3. of navigators (making a circuit)

G4033

περικυκλόω

perikukloo

per-ee-koo-klo'-o

Verb

from G4012 and G2944; to encircle all around, i.e. blockade completely:--compass round.

  1. to encircle, compass about
    1. of a city (besieged)

H2329

חוּג

chuwg

khoog

Noun Masculine

from H2328; a circle:--circle, circuit, compass.

  1. circle, circuit, compass
  2. (BDB) vault (of the heavens)

H4230

מְחוּגָה

mchuwgah

mekk-oo-gaw'

Noun Feminine

from H2328; an instrument for marking a circle, i.e. compasses:--compass.

  1. circle-instrument, compass

H5437

סָבַב

cabab

saw-bab'

Verb

a primitive root; to revolve, surround, or border; used in various applications, literally and figuratively (as follows):--bring, cast, fetch, lead, make, walk, × whirl, × round about, be about on every side, apply, avoid, beset (about), besiege, bring again, carry (about), change, cause to come about, × circuit, (fetch a) compass (about, round), drive, environ, × on every side, beset (close, come, compass, go, stand) round about, inclose, remove, return, set, sit down, turn (self) (about, aside, away, back).

  1. to turn, turn about or around or aside or back or towards, go about or around, surround, encircle, change direction
    1. (Qal)
      1. to turn, turn about, be brought round, change
      2. to march or walk around, go partly around, circle about, skirt, make a round, make a circuit, go about to, surround, encompass
    2. (Niphal)
      1. to turn oneself, close round, turn round
      2. to be turned over to
    3. (Piel) to turn about, change, transform
    4. (Poel)
      1. to encompass, surround
      2. to come about, assemble round
      3. to march, go about
      4. to enclose, envelop
    5. (Hiphil)
      1. to turn, cause to turn, turn back, reverse, bring over, turn into, bring round
      2. to cause to go around, surround, encompass
    6. (Hophal)
      1. to be turned
      2. to be surrounded
